When a driver seeks for help, the workflow ordinarily begins with a calm and courteous operator who gathers important details. This includes the contact's position, the nature of the issue, and any applicable facts about the vehicle. The dispatcher then assesses the condition to decide the proper action.
After completing the initial assessment, a technician is sent to the scene. The expected arrival time is communicated to the caller, offering peace of mind during a challenging time. How quickly might I expect assistance to show up?
Assistance can typically reach you in 30 to 45 minutes, depending on location and traffic conditions. Factors such as the time of day and service demand may also influence the arrival time of assistance.
What age restrictions exist for roadside assistance offerings?
The majority of emergency roadside services do not set age requirements; however, certain providers may require the account holder to be at least 18 years old. It's best to look into specific service terms for detailed requirements.

What Ought to I Do if I'M Trapped in a Perilous Location?
If stuck in a dangerous area, the person should remain in the vehicle, fasten the doors, and contact for help. If possible, flag for support using hazard lights or a brightly colored cloth.
